I was surprised to not see a horn relay on the firewall. there is the 2 wire "L" connector/wire going up to the horn under the hood (no idea if this is OE or not) & there is something missing on the firewall just behind the cyl head (I thought it was the ballast but the ballast is there further to the drivers side). I think that that might be the voltage reg that is missing.
